I'm considering swapping out my six speed for a Mazdaspeed. If I broke a six speed with power I would be kind of proud though considering their "rep" is very good.
I can pick up a pair of Mazdaspeed axles for about $300 but I'm concerned that they're not plug and play with a non-Mazdaspeed diff. Does anyone have any data on that? I think I'll call FM tomorrow; since they posted this pic I hope they have the datas.
Flyin' Miata : Projects : Projects in the shop
I can pick up a pair of Mazdaspeed axles for about $300 but I'm concerned that they're not plug and play with a non-Mazdaspeed diff. Does anyone have any data on that? I think I'll call FM tomorrow; since they posted this pic I hope they have the datas.
Flyin' Miata : Projects : Projects in the shop
The MS axles will only work with the MS diff. The splines are of a different size and tooth number and will not interchange with any other Miata rear end. As a matter of interest, the MS diff internals are essentially the same as in the S2000.

I'm having a MSM diff built right now with a 3.6 r&p and OS-Giken LSD, so I should have the Bosch Torsen out of the MSM diff available at some point soon. You need the MSM Bosch Torsen LSD or OSG LSD to use the MSM axles.
